 I'm not sure I understand your logic. The 360 right now has what is pretty much unarguably the best RPG line up on the 3 consoles. And that's not likely to change until some of the PS3's big hitters like FFXIII comes out. But either way, the 360 is now a proven RPG system, so it's a bit unfair to say that.

 As far as buying Sakaguchi, the man was thrown out by Square (for his financial debacle Spirits Within). In Japanese business culture, a fuck up like that generally gets you black listed, and if your a senior guy like he was, a desk job with no power until retirement. The guy wanted to make games, MS funding made it possible. It's not MS's fault Sony and Nintendo didn't actively pursue the guy. As far as Nobuo Uematsu goes, he's worked with Sakaguchi for decades, it's no surprise he's chosen to continue working with him. Plus, isn't he still technically at Square-Enix?
